It is crucial for a homeowner to install flag hinges when installing a uPVC Composite Door. They will help hold the weight of the sash which is the component of the door which moves when the door opens and closes. A sash usually requires x3 of these flag hinges. The top and bottom hinge should be set at a distance of 150mm from the sash. The middle hinge should be placed at a similar distance between the two outer hinges.

A sash can be opened horizontally or vertically. The sash of a door is secured in place when closed by an locking device that includes a latch and a deadbolt. A striker is placed on the inside of doors to engage the deadbolt and latch and ensure they are synchronised. The striker is typically fixed to the frame, but can be replaced when damaged.

Craking and squeaking are two of the most frequent problems faced by composite door crack repair doors. These issues are caused by the expansion and contraction of the composite door frame. This can cause the hinges to move and make them more difficult to open and close. To avoid this, it's important to lubricate the hinges and locks.

Another issue that can arise with composite doors is the possibility of water seepage. This is typically due to a blocked drain system. The drainage system consists of holes in the bottom of the thresholds that let excess water drain away from your home. It's important to inspect these drainage holes on a regular basis to ensure they're working properly.

Letterplates

The letter plate is a crucial piece of furniture at the front of the house that allows mail and small parcels to be delivered in a safe manner without the need homeowners to open their doors. They are also an ideal place to store incoming mail, protecting it from theft and weather until the recipient is able to retrieve it. A letterplate can be placed directly on a wall, door or other surface to cover an opening and they are available in a range of styles and finishes for an ideal match with the rest of your composite doors.

Yale Postmaster letterplates, for example are available in stainless steel, heritage black, chrome, and satin silver. They can be put on doors made of wood or uPVC with thicknesses up to 70mm. It is also possible to find high security options like the Soterian slim TS 008, which has innovative serrated stays that prevent the flap from opening too wide and protects against key fishing and locking manipulation.
